Abstract Nowadays, the interest in natural antioxidants (especially phenolics) for the prevention of oxidative stress-related diseases is increasing due to their fewer side effects and more potent activity than some of their synthetic analogues. New chemical and pharmacological studies of well-known herbal substances are among the current trends in medicinal plant research. Meadowsweet (Filipendula ulmaria) is a popular herb used in traditional medicine to treat various diseases (antirheumatic, in-flammatory, tumor prevention etc.). Dry tincture of Filipendulae ulmariae herba, collected from the Bulgarian flora, was analyzed by HPLC method and bioassayed for activities - antioxidant, anti-proliferative and DNA-protective against oxidative damage. The HPLC phenolic profile showed 12 phenolics, of which salicylic acid (18.84 mg/g dry extract), rutin (9.97 mg/g de), p-coumaric acid (6.80 mg/g de), quercetin (4.47 mg/g de), rosmarinic acid (4.01 mg/g de), and vanillic acid (3.82 mg/g de) were the major components. The high antioxidant potential of the species was confirmed by using four methods, best expressed in CUPRAC assay (10 605.91 μM TE/g de). The present study reports for the first time а high protection against oxidative DNA damage and an antiproliferative effect against hepatocellular carcinoma (HepG2 cell line). Meadowsweet dry tincture possesses a high potential to prevent diseases caused by oxidative stress.
